A college's ethnic diversity is indicated by the student body's equal inclusion of students from different backgrounds . Students at Penn State Beaver are mostly White with a small Black population. The school has low racial diversity. 25% percent of students are minorities or people of color (BIPOC). The ethnic breakdown is detailed in the following table.
| Race | Percent of Students |
|---|---|
| White |
75%
|
| Black |
9%
|
| Hispanic |
5%
|
| Asian |
3%
|
| American Indian / Alaskan |
0%
|
| Hawaiian / Pacific Islander |
0%
|
| Two or more races |
2%
|
| International |
3%
|
| Race Unknown |
1%
|
